Written statement made by Baroness Ashton of Upholland (Labour) on Monday, 10 October 2005 in the House of Lords, on behalf of the Department for Constitutional Affairs.
Solicitors (Compensation for Inadequate Professional Services) Order 2005
My honourable friend the Parliamentary Under-Secretary of State has made the following Written Ministerial Statement. The Government have today laid before Parliament the following instrument:"Solicitors (Compensation for Inadequate Professional Services) Order 2005." The order, made under paragraph 3(2) of Schedule 1A to the Solicitors Act 1974, will raise the maximum limit on the compensation which the Law Society's Council may direct a solicitor to pay on a complaint of inadequate professional service. The limit is raised from £5,000 to £15,000 with effect from 1 January 2006. From 1 January, consumers seeking compensation for inadequate professional service will be able to benefit from the increased compensation level which the Law Society can order and avoid the necessity of automatically having to take court action in order to claim redress in those cases. The revised limit will apply to those cases where a complaint of inadequate professional service is made to the Law Society by the complainant after 1 January 2006. My department and the Law Society are in agreement that raising the compensation level would be in the interest of, and welcomed by, the consumer. At present, if the compensation claimed is greater than £5,000 the Law Society cannot deal with it. This means that a complainant frequently has to retain the services of a further solicitor in order to get redress from the solicitor who generated the original complaint. This can be a lengthy and expensive process for a consumer. Raising the limit will enable a far greater proportion of complainants to obtain adequate redress without the need to resort to court proceedings.
